Pub food: BBQ Chicken pizza was okay. The Triple Dick - their version of chips & salsa (very chunky like I like), queso (my favorite - had a tiny bit of smoke which was surprising and notably good), and guacamole. I wish the chips were warmed as that would be the bomb! We were served by the proprietor who was kind, patient and funny. He also shared a dragon fruit based shake recipe that his daughter came up which was amazingly good and made with two different kinds of seltzers - who knew? This place is open, inviting and definitely lets you know it's a brewery, dog friendly, relaxing and fun. If you are in downtown Auburn, stop by!

The highest level of excellence is what my feeling of coming here was like. This is your neighborhood brewery/hang out space Auburn!! Well designed and well thought out layout that absolutely will charm your way in and invite you to stay for the many selections of beer and games. This place is a labor of love and it shows in every aspect and every corner of this place. We came on a weekend afternoon and so glad we did. We were able to play some cribbage, drink through a variety of beer options. I'm personally excited about the cribbage tournaments that they host. There are a few options for some bites too. Definitely will be back!

Definitely a cool spot to grab a drink and love the theme! The bartender told me they are moving locations to increase the size and will be three blocks away. Currently they are out of a few things (beer and food) because of the planned move. I still give this place 5 stars. They had board games, card games, dart boards and arcade golf. Outdoor seating was decent. Service was great

Checking in from Auburn, WA! Let's mix this review up a bit. Give the readers information to let them make an informed decision. Downtown has a small city feel. I feel pretty safe compared to larger cities. It's right by the train tracks, hence the name. It's a small place with a large selection. Its kind of a mix between seltzer, IPAs, and jalapeño flavored. My particular drink was the Stack Haze. Not bad, and I usually don't drink IPAs. Give them a try, smaller place, 2 bathrooms, and a friendly bartender.
